## Step 2: Swap in the new comparator

Reviewer note: ParityPeek's old comparator rounded rates before comparing, which hid sub-dollar mismatches across channels. The new one compares raw values and flags anything over the tolerance. Make sure the rollout branch updates the checker's settings too, not just the code. The values the new comparator expects are listed below.

config for kafof-bawef:
holath:
  log_level: debug
  metrics_host: metrics.holath.qorvelsys.internal
  pin: 2191
  pool_size: 32

## Authentication

Heads up: the nightly reindex job (`reindex_nightly.py`) talks to the Lanternfish search cluster, and that cluster won't accept anonymous writes anymore — we locked it down last sprint. The job now authenticates as the `reindex-runner` service identity against Corvid Gateway, and the token is injected via the `LF_INDEX_TOKEN` env var in the scheduler config. Nothing clever going on, just a bearer header on every batch request. For review purposes, the staging credential currently in use is listed below.

service key, kadug-kadup: kto15_rN23XLAYImmZgrJ

Runbook: Splitlane assignment service

When a customer says they're seeing the wrong experiment variant, first check whether Splitlane's bucketing cache is stale — that covers most cases. Flushing the cache is safe and takes effect within a minute. If variants still look off, compare the pod's live config against what's documented. For quick reference, the service currently runs with these values.

config for bahop-fajep:
DRUATH_PIN=4501
DRUATH_TENANT=briwyn
DRUATH_METRICS_HOST=metrics.druath.brasksoft.test
DRUATH_SEAL=seal_7d2e069d
DRUATH_STANDBY_TEAM=olieth

# worker.env — Hartwell Library catalogue import
# Reviewer notes: this file drives the nightly MARC import from the
# Corvane union catalogue into the Hartwell discovery index.
# Batch size capped at 500 records; the dedupe pass runs after each batch.
# Do not enable PARALLEL_IMPORT until the locking fix in importd 2.4 lands.
# All values here are environment-specific; staging uses the mirror feed.
# The import daemon authenticates to the Corvane feed using the credential set on the next line.

vault entry, yahif-yajep: COURIER_KEY29=b802bdf8034096b65a51c6ba5abe2